Hello,
I've getting recurrent messages as follows;
[Hardware Error]: No human readable MCE decoding support on this CPU type.
[Hardware Error]: Run the message through 'mcelog --ascii' to decode.
[Hardware Error]: Machine check events logged
[Hardware Error]: No human readable MCE decoding support on this CPU type.
[Hardware Error]: Run the message through 'mcelog --ascii' to decode.
[Hardware Error]: Machine check events logged

The system is running RHEL 6.1 , kernel `2.6.32-131.0.15.el6.x86_64 #1 SMP Tue May 10 15:42:40 EDT 2011 x86_64 x86_64 x86_64 GNU/Linux`

What does this mean?

Is it a bug as indicated in http://mcelog.org/faq.html#13 ?

https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=621669
Bug 621669 - mcelog: Unknown Intel CPU type for Xeon X5650

It looks like there's an mcelog bug on Bugzilla for the X5650, but on RHEL5. I don't see a "fix", and I don't see a RHEL6-specific ticket for it either. Also, the link to the Errata listed in the ticket does not appear to be valid either.

To answer your question--it appears to be a bug.

Amr,

You are right. Looks like you are hitting following bug.

http://www.mcelog.org/faq.html#13

It is addressed in following bugzilla.

https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=621669

and fixed in kernel-2.6.32-220.

Updating to the above kernel should fix the issue.
